Accessibility issue you haven’t considered in your business:

Hand dryers aren’t always accessible for mobility users. A hand dryer that isn’t as strong as me blowing on my hands, isn’t drying anything. Now I have to try not to slip off my mobility device with wet hands. Which can lead to falls.

For folks using screen readers. Apologies. I missed the alt text button. Top says Alberta Vaccine Booking System.

Then:
Pre-ordering of vaccines for the 2026-2027 immunization season starts on Sept 29 & ends on Dec 15. Vaccines can only be pre-ordered during this period.

Below: booking page
Heads up Alberta. You only get this info if you click “preorder vaccine-order vaccines.” Found out from another friend with cancer. Not great for folks at risk.
